Simulation of the guiding of the high-energy laser pulse train (red) through a plasma channel (blue). The pulse train resonantly excites a large amplitude plasma wave that can be used to accelerate charged particles to GeV-scale energies

Advance in laser-driven accelerators

Researchers from the Department of Physics have taken a step closer to demonstrating a new generation of high-repetition-rate laser-driven particle accelerators; these compact accelerators could drive myriad applications.

Long-predicted quantum state confirmed

The Macroscopic Quantum Matter Group at the University of Oxford has made a significant discovery, identifying and visualising a long-predicted new phase of matter in high-temperature superconductors.
